Your role

It is a hybrid role.


As a member of the French radio Finance & Administration team and reporting to the Senior Manager, Budgeting and Internal Reporting, you coordinate and assist leadership with French radio management activities on behalf of Finance & Administration and Human Resources.


You play a key role in coordinating contracts and approving payments to on-air guests and contract contributors to French radio.

You are also involved in the department's financial management by producing estimates for some shows and participating in the network's budgeting and forecasting process.

Key responsibilities:


  • Work jointly with radio production teams on the hiring and compensation of program contributors, and provide production teams with daytoday support on policy and budget issues.
  • Coordinate the drafting of employment contracts for staff and performers, handle related administrative processes and authorize payments.
  • Develop monitoring and tracking tools to facilitate the department's financial management, and help optimize the department's administrative processes.
  • Investigate and resolve administrative issues, and answer compensationrelated questions from staff and performers.
  • Develop radio programming production budgets and help with the forecasting process.
  • Related tasks include checking and approving all manner of expense claims, assisting with the monthly closing process and producing analysis reports to help radio leadership achieve various objectives.
